I have a powerbook that all of a sudden has developed sleep issues. I have dealt with this a lot on my iMac so know all the PRAM resets etc, but can't figure out the Powerbook.

Screen will go blank and light come on but no flashing and hard drives don't spin down. I did a system restore with the factory discs and that fixed things for two days and then it started acting up again. I have dl'd all the latest software updates, reset the CMU, PRAM and repaired permissions. No peripherals are attached.

HELP!!!! this is driving me crazy
 
Does this happen in the middle of you doing something? Unlike the iMac, the PowerBook's screen will go to sleep before the machine does, by default. Does pressing a random key bring everything back promptly?
